"aligning option buttons"
 
I can align and distribute text boxes on my form with the options in the
drawing menu. I cannot align or distribute option buttons or check boxes the
same way as I can only select one at a time. Ctrl-select or shift-select
does not do it. Any help greatly appreciated!

"aligning option buttons"
 
I could click on the first checkbox and ctrl-click on the subsequent checkbox
and all would be selected.

I tested with checkboxes from both the forms toolbar and from the control
toolbox toolbar.
